использование пользовательских атрибутов openid в моей среде - PullRequest
0 голосов
/ 31 января 2011

Я могу настроить сервер openid, который будет поддерживать сложные атрибуты, которые не определены (список http://www.axschema.org/types/) или экспериментальный список). Атрибутами могут быть подробные сведения о его работе, такие как идентификатор босса для отчетов и т. Д. Мой сервер и клиент openidоба находятся под моим контролем и не должны быть доступны для Интернета.

Можно ли создать эту среду в протоколе OpenId? Если да, пожалуйста, предложите, какие серверы поддерживают сложные атрибуты, если таковые имеются.

1 Ответ

1 голос
/ 05 февраля 2011

Протокол обмена атрибутами довольно прост:

http://openid.net/specs/openid-attribute-exchange-1_0.html

Вам, несомненно, потребуется изменить его для поддержки этих нестандартных полей (вдвойне, потому что вы, вероятно, тянетеданные из LDAP или другой базы данных), но это не должно быть сложно.

(Что касается самого обмена атрибутами, почти все реализации с открытым исходным кодом поддерживают это.)

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...